Transaction 157c903caf98fc5b795174750d9054478d2c556859847c124e5ca114286ae5a1

1 Input
2 Outputs
  • 157c903caf98fc5b795174750d9054478d2c556859847c124e5ca114286ae5a1:0
  • value  1300025
    address  15K1iauVThzda3j914wBe95KMvqbWnVKVk
  • 157c903caf98fc5b795174750d9054478d2c556859847c124e5ca114286ae5a1:1
  • value  3931807
    address  13V8GQfMkDG5ecuS23w1U9nPvSSMDBL718